There are some fairly potent boons to unlock during Act 2.
Unlocking them requires alternating between the Path of Resolve & Ambition and "playing" the Court of Blades.
Dunking is how you get them.
Dunking resources at the Taken altar by the start-up points (Rng).
1. Essentia
2. Sigil Shards once you unlock and pick that perk.
